The Central Office Administrator maintains administrative systems in the Mathematics Department and provides administrative and operational support to students, staff, and visitors of the department, particularly those in the Applied Mathematics and Mathematical Physics (AMMP) Section. The key areas of responsibility are in administration, finance, space and facilities, recruitment and selection, health and safety, along with some general responsibilities.
